Paintings fields was a long time on my todo list. I waited for a perfect spring day to go out near Ashdod and came out with this. Oil on canvas, stretched on a pine frame.

Ludmila (Luda) Berenstein born in Ashgabat Turkmenistan. Since my early childhood drawing was a significant part of my life. This desire led me to study in the academic school of arts which I graduated with a teacher certificate . From that point on, Art has always been an integral part of everything I did. In 1991 my family and I moved to Israel - a major change in my life. My love of painting never faded and these days I am privileged to reflect the beauty of the holy land in my painting. Plain air and mother nature have been my teachers and helped improve my technic to where it is today. As an artist my goal is to memorize a moment in space while following some principles that involve lines, colors, rhyme and realism. My art works are regularly displayed in art shows across Israel , museums of Russia and Ukraine hold two of my pieces as well as some of private collectors in Greece, Monte Negro, Russia and the Ukraine. Through my work I’m aiming to share my positive attitude with the world, hoping to bring others pleasure that grows from a very sincere energy of love .
